Resumo
The cowpea has a great nutritional and economic importance, especially for the poorest
population in the North and Northeast regions of Brazil. This crop is able to produce high yields of grains per hectare, however it can suffer influence of the cultivation conditions, which it is submitted. Thus, the objective of this research was to evaluate the competition effect of Brachiaria plantaginea at different levels of infestation and submitted a periods of water restriction, on the growth and development characteristics of cowpea. The experimental design was completely randomized design, using a 3x2 factorial scheme. The treatments were weed densities (0, 3, 6 plants per pot) and two water regimes (irrigated plants and water restriction period). In the control treatment, the plants were maintained irrigated by 47 days after. The rates of photosynthesis (Pmax), stomatal conductance (gs), internal carbon concentration (Ci), respiration (E), water use efficiency (US), intrinsic water use efficiency (EiUA) and chloroplastidic pigments, evidencing that the lower physiological indexes occurred due to the water restriction. The cowpea MST accumulation was higher when cultivated in the absence of B. plantaginea under irrigated plants regime, on average 7.3 g per plant. The total dry matter of the weeds was higher in the higher planting density, on average 2.3 plants per pot, independent of the water regime. The proline content in the cowpea leaves increased due the presence of three weeds with the water restriction period, possibly by the interspecific competition for water in the V5 phase of cowpea. The enzymatic activity of dismutase superoxide, catalase and ascobate peroxidase was higher in response to the density of three or six weeds, independently of the water regime.
Key-words: Competition, B. plantagiena, density of plants, production.
